  11. Reading Comprehension – Short Passage
    Read the following passage and answer questions 11-15.
    “In recent years, urban planners have turned their attention to green infrastructure as a means of enhancing resilience and sustainability. By integrating parks, wetlands, and tree-lined pathways into city design, municipalities hope to reduce heat islands, improve air quality, and manage stormwater naturally. Critics, however, warn that without proper maintenance and community engagement, green infrastructure can fall into neglect and undermine its intended benefits.”
    11. What is the primary purpose of the passage?
    A. To explain how urban parks are designed.
    B. To critique current city planning strategies.
    C. To introduce the concept of green infrastructure and its benefits.
    D. To argue that maintenance is unimportant.
    E. To describe tree-lined pathways only.
    Jawaban: C
    12. According to the passage, which of the following is a benefit of green infrastructure?
    A. Increased traffic congestion.
    B. Improved air quality.
    C. Reduced tree-lined pathways.
    D. Decreased community engagement.
    E. More neglect over time.
    Jawaban: B

C. Tips Efektif Persiapan TKA Bahasa Inggris

Berikut beberapa strategi yang dapat membantu siswa SMA/SMK dalam mempersiapkan diri menghadapi TKA Bahasa Inggris Tingkat Lanjut:

  • Latihan rutin – Kerjakan soal-latihan seperti di atas secara berkala untuk membiasakan diri dengan format soal pilihan ganda dan tipe-soal yang menguji kemampuan analitis dan bahasa.
  • Pahami kisi-kisi kompetensi – Menurut informasi resmi, mapel Bahasa Inggris Tingkat Lanjut untuk TKA mencakup pemahaman tekstual, inferensial, dan evaluatif dari bacaan. :contentReference[oaicite:1]{index=1}
  • Kembangkan kosakata akademik – Karena banyak soal yang menggunakan istilah akademik atau kontekstual, penting untuk sering membaca artikel, jurnal populer, maupun laporan ringkas dalam bahasa Inggris.
  • Latihan membaca lebih lama dan refleksi – Teks bacaan dalam soal TKA bisa cukup panjang dan kompleks; latih diri untuk membaca cepat namun tetap memahami ide pokok, detail, dan implikasi.
  • Berpikir kritis – Banyak soal menguji bukan hanya “apa” tetapi juga “mengapa” dan “bagaimana”. Misalnya, inferensi dan evaluasi merupakan bagian dari kompetensi yang diujikan. :contentReference[oaicite:2]{index=2}
  • Simulasi kondisi ujian – Kerjakan latihan soal dalam waktu terbatas dan usahakan meminimalkan gangguan agar kondisi mirip ujian sungguhan.
